Why Players Expect a Venom Rework Soon

From experience, Blox Fruits rarely reworks a fruit without first building some discussion around it. We usually see a pattern: a fruit gets mentioned more often, players notice recent design trends, and then it shows up in a larger update.

 

Venom checks those boxes.

 

Main reasons Venom is being watched

  • It is a popular Mythical fruit
  • Recent reworks gave several fruits an M1
  • Venom still has room for a cleaner combat flow
  • It fits the current update direction better than many older fruits

 

For regular players, this means Venom is no longer just a wish-list fruit. It is part of the real update conversation.

Venom M1: The Most Important Change

If Venom gets reworked, the M1 is probably the first thing players will look for.

 

Why? Because recent fruit reworks have made basic attacks more important, even for fruits that were not originally known for that kind of combat style.

 

Most likely M1 ideas

M1 TypeFit for VenomWhy It Works
Venom blade Very High Clean for combos and close-range pressure
Toxic claws High Fast, aggressive, and easy to animate
Acid whip Medium Good theme, but less likely for combo flow

 

From a gameplay view, Venom blade feels the most realistic. It matches the fruit's poison theme while giving it the kind of modern melee identity that many reworked fruits now have.

 

If you use Venom in PvP, this matters a lot. A solid M1 would make the fruit feel smoother in neutral fights and much less dependent on cooldown timing.

What Players Should Do Right Now

This part is simple.

 

If you main Venom

  • Save fragments and reset options
  • Practice closer-range fighting
  • Stay flexible with your build

 

If you trade

  • Be careful with hype pricing
  • Avoid panic buys
  • Wait for stronger update signals before going all-in

 

If you grind

  • Do not rebuild early
  • Watch for M1 details first
  • Keep Venom on your shortlist if you want a better hybrid fruit

 

That is the safest approach. Prepare for the update, but do not burn resources on rumors alone.
